Characterization in terms of K-functionals of quasilinear operators of weak types $\left( \Lambda_{\varphi_0, 1}, \Lambda_{\psi_0, \infty} \right)$, $\left( \Lambda_{\varphi_1, 1}, \Lambda_{\psi_1, 1} \right)$

We obtain necessary and sufficient condition in terms of K-functionals of pairs of Lorentz spaces for quasilinear operator to act boundedly from pair of Lorentz spaces $\left( \Lambda_{\varphi_1 1}(\mathbb{R}^n), \Lambda_{\varphi_2 1}(\mathbb{R}^n) \right)$ to pair of Lorentz spaces $\left( \Lambda_{\psi_1 \infty}(\mathbb{R}^n), \Lambda_{\psi_2 \infty}(\mathbb{R}^n) \right)$.
